[QUOTE=redbullapril23]iguys who are throwing the codes what plugs are you runnin?


I seriously doubt if a P0152 code is related to a plug issue......I had the code with both the factory OEM plugs and two different heat ranges of Denso irridiums........that is three(3) different sets of plugs in the car...

And to repeat my first post, I doubt if it is the O2 sensors as I threw the codes both with the OEM sensors and new Denso sensors, no difference.

I think the fact that I ALWAYS throw the code about 3-5 miles after a cold start is a BIG clue......but I still don't get it?????
